Abstract
Microsomal preparations from chimpanzee liver can transfer glucose from UDPglucose to the 17α-hydroxyl group of 17α-estradiol and of 17α-estradiol-3-glucuronide. A phenolic glucoside of estrone, but not of either 17α- or 17β-estradiol is also formed. No formation of glucosides, of p-nitrophenol, or of diethylstilbestrol was demonstrated.
